Output 16f2a3e4e40623afb6100763d1bf10f9da140b89b7171a23e3a0a23f093d09d4:0

value
588841
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51c6050398f23578648452f5ea2d6ec8dde5fdf2ca8dff0c3f31fd25bdc854ec
address
bc1p28rq2quc7g6hseyy2t675ttwerw7tl0je2xl7rplx87jt0wg2nkq5v80st
transaction
16f2a3e4e40623afb6100763d1bf10f9da140b89b7171a23e3a0a23f093d09d4
spent
true